      <title><![CDATA[Police break up a group involved in illegal motorcycle races in Palma]]></title>
      <link><![CDATA[https://en.arabalears.cat/society/police-break-up-group-involved-in-illegal-motorcycle-races-in-palma_1_5643969.html]]></link>
      <description><![CDATA[<p><img src="https://static1.ara.cat/clip/4ced2c79-37df-4ed3-927c-262cfe90b384_16-9-aspect-ratio_default_1056091.jpg" /></p><p>The Palma Local Police broke up a massive drinking party with a large number of young people, many of them minors, and illegal street races involving motorcycles and cars on the Son Roca road. According to information provided by the force, the operation took place on February 6th, resulting in 50 people being identified, 40 vehicles (mainly mopeds) being inspected, nine motorcycles being impounded, and four drug-related charges being filed. </p>]]></description>

      <title><![CDATA[Three sound level meters installed in the Serra de Tramuntana]]></title>
      <link><![CDATA[https://en.arabalears.cat/society/three-sound-level-meters-installed-in-the-serra-tramuntana_1_5451251.html]]></link>
      <description><![CDATA[<p><img src="https://static1.ara.cat/clip/974161f3-11b1-409c-91df-8f441b8ebbec_16-9-aspect-ratio_default_0.jpg" /></p><p>The Sierra de Tramuntana Association (Mancomunidad de la Sierra de Tramuntana) has acquired three mobile sound level meters, which have already begun to be used to impose fines of up to €300,000 on vehicles exceeding 90 decibels. This measure, which will be applied only in urban areas—where the local councils have jurisdiction—aims to "raise awareness" so that residents of the Serra "can feel safe in their homes," explains the president of the Association, Bernat Isern.</p>]]></description>
